You can use the substitution method. Using the first equation in terms of y, y = 5 - x Substitute this to the second equation to get the value of x. x - 2(5 - x) = 2 x - 10 + 2x = 2 3x = 2 + 10 3x = 12 x = 4
For y, just substitute the value of x that we have used in the first equation. y = 5 - 4 = 1
